Rachel Carson
An American marine biologist and author whose 1962 book "Silent Spring" helped advance the global environmental movement by highlighting the dangers of unregulated pesticide use.
Our Bodies, Ourselves
A book first published in 1970 offering comprehensive information on women's health and sexuality, marking a milestone in women's health advocacy.
Great Society
A set of domestic programs in the United States launched by President Lyndon B. Johnson aimed at eliminating poverty and racial injustice.
New Deal
A series of programs, public work projects, financial reforms, and regulations enacted by President Franklin D. Roosevelt in the United States during the 1930s to help recover from the Great Depression.
